psychology dissertation inclusion and exclusion criteria turn an abstract target population into a reproducible decision rule. They state who or what can enter a study, who or what cannot, and why. Well-designed criteria protect participants, align the sample with the research question, reduce avoidable bias, and let readers judge where the findings apply.

This guide shows how to develop, justify, apply, and report criteria for participant research, secondary data studies, systematic reviews, scoping reviews, and meta-analyses. It also separates eligibility decisions from sampling, withdrawal, and analysis exclusions, which are often confused in dissertation methods chapters.

What a Pyschology Dissertation inclusion and exclusion criteria do

Inclusion criteria are the characteristics that every eligible case must meet. Exclusion criteria identify circumstances that disqualify a case that might otherwise appear eligible. A case may be a person, interview, organisation, document, database record, or published study. The unit depends on the design.

Criteria should translate the population named in the research question into observable rules. For example, “university students experiencing academic stress” is not yet operational enough. A protocol might define current enrolment, minimum age, language needed for the validated measure, and a specified score range on a named screening instrument. Each rule needs a scientific, ethical, or practical justification.

Reporting guidance treats eligibility as a core method, not an administrative detail. The STROBE cohort checklist asks researchers to report eligibility criteria plus the sources and methods used to select participants. It also recommends reporting numbers at each stage, reasons for non-participation, and, when useful, a flow diagram.

Eligibility is not the same as sampling

Decision Question answered Psychology example
Eligibility criteria Who or what may enter? Adults currently enrolled at a university and able to complete questionnaires in a validated study language
Sampling strategy How are eligible cases approached or selected? Stratified sampling by year of study
Withdrawal rule When may an enrolled participant leave? A participant may stop at any time without giving a reason
Analysis exclusion When is collected data omitted from a specific analysis? A prespecified failed attention check or missing primary outcome

Eligibility is decided before enrolment or record inclusion. Sampling is the route used to recruit among eligible cases. Withdrawal occurs after enrolment and must respect participant rights. Analysis exclusions happen after data collection and can create serious bias if invented after results are visible. Keep these decisions separate in the protocol, participant flow record, and dissertation.

Derive criteria from the research question

Begin with the constructs, population, context, timeframe, and design in the research question. Then ask what must be true for the case to provide interpretable evidence. Do not start with a convenient recruitment pool and reverse-engineer a question around it.

Map each criterion to a defensible reason

A useful eligibility rule normally has one or more of four foundations:

  • Scientific fit: the case represents the population or phenomenon required by the question.
  • Measurement validity: the measures can capture the intended constructs for that case.
  • Ethical protection: participation would be appropriate under the approved consent and risk procedures.
  • Feasibility: the research team can complete the protocol reliably within the stated setting and period.

Feasibility alone is a weak reason for excluding a group when reasonable accommodations could make participation possible. A dissertation should explain why a criterion is necessary and consider how it changes representativeness. The CIOMS international ethical guidelines emphasise scientific and social value, protection of participants, and reasoned conditions for involving potentially vulnerable groups. Local institutional guidance and ethics approval remain essential because requirements vary by setting and study.

Write criteria as observable decisions

A criterion should let two trained screeners reach the same answer from the same information. Replace vague adjectives with a source, threshold, timeframe, or verification process.

Vague rule More reproducible rule Why it is stronger
Young adults Aged 18 to 25 years on the consent date Defines the boundary and date
High stress Score at or above the prespecified threshold on the named validated scale Links the decision to a measure
Regular social media user Self-reported use on at least five days per week during the past three months Defines frequency and recall period
Good English Able to understand the consent information and complete the English-language instrument without translation Ties language to the actual task
Complete records Contains the exposure, outcome, age, and prespecified covariates required by the analysis plan Names required variables

Thresholds should not appear from nowhere. Cite the measure manual or validation evidence, explain a clinically or theoretically meaningful boundary, or identify the threshold as a pragmatic protocol choice. Where a continuous variable can remain continuous, a cutoff may discard information and narrow generalisability without improving the design.

Common types of participant criteria

Not every study needs every category. Use only the rules necessary for the question and protocol.

  • Population characteristics: age range, education stage, occupation, caregiving role, or another directly relevant characteristic.
  • Phenomenon or exposure: experience of bereavement, use of a service, exposure to a workplace condition, or a score on a screening measure.
  • Setting and timeframe: enrolment at participating institutions or experience during a defined period.
  • Communication and consent: ability to understand the approved information and provide the form of consent required by the protocol.
  • Protocol compatibility: access to required equipment, capacity to attend sessions, or no conflicting intervention when scientifically necessary.
  • Safety: a condition that would make a task unacceptably risky, based on the actual study procedures rather than a broad diagnostic label.

A diagnosis should not be used as a proxy for inability to consent, unreliability, or risk. Assess the relevant capability or risk directly when possible. If translated materials, accessible formats, remote participation, breaks, or supported consent can remove a barrier, discuss those options with the supervisor and ethics committee before excluding people.

Example: sleep and working memory survey

Suppose a cross-sectional dissertation asks whether sleep quality is associated with working memory among undergraduate students. Inclusion might require current undergraduate enrolment, age 18 or older, and ability to complete the validated instruments in an available language. An exclusion might cover a documented protocol conflict, such as participation in a concurrent sleep intervention if that would alter the focal association.

Excluding every participant who uses medication, reports any mental health condition, or works night shifts would usually require strong justification. Those characteristics may be measured as covariates, described as sample features, or examined in sensitivity analyses instead. The choice depends on the causal reasoning and available sample, not on a desire for a perfectly uniform group.

Example: qualitative lived-experience interview

For interviews about adjustment during the first year after international relocation, eligibility might require having moved to the study country within the previous 12 months, being at least 18, and being able to take part in an interview using one of the study languages. The researcher should define “moved” and the reference date. Recruitment should seek variation relevant to the question rather than treating demographic diversity as statistical representativeness.

A qualitative criterion should support information-rich accounts without predetermining the themes. “Participants who experienced successful adjustment” would bias a study intended to explore the full range of adjustment. A neutral temporal or experiential definition is more defensible.

Example: intervention or experimental study

An online attention-training experiment might include adults within the approved age range who can use the required device and complete baseline assessment. Exclusion criteria could address previous exposure to the exact experimental task or a safety issue caused by the stimulus. The current CONSORT reporting guideline provides the relevant framework for randomised trials, while specialised extensions may apply to social and psychological interventions.

Eligibility should be assessed before random assignment. Failure to finish the intervention later is attrition, not retrospective ineligibility. Analyse and report it according to the prespecified plan.

Criteria for reviews and evidence syntheses

In a systematic review, criteria define which reports and studies contribute evidence. They should be established before screening begins and applied consistently at title and abstract screening, full-text screening, and data extraction.

The PRISMA 2020 checklist includes reporting recommendations for eligibility and study selection. Its flow diagram maps records identified, included, and excluded, with reasons for full-text exclusions. These tools support transparent reporting but do not design the review question for you.

Build criteria from a framework

For intervention questions, Population, Intervention, Comparator, Outcomes, and Study design can structure eligibility. Qualitative questions may be better served by Sample, Phenomenon of Interest, Design, Evaluation, and Research type. Choose a framework that fits the question rather than forcing every review into one template.

Domain Example inclusion rule Possible exclusion reason
Population Adults providing unpaid care to a relative with dementia Paid professional caregivers only
Phenomenon Psychological experiences of caregiver burden Physical workload only, without psychological outcomes
Design Peer-reviewed qualitative studies using interviews or focus groups Editorial, protocol, or purely quantitative survey
Timeframe Studies published from 2000 through the final search date Published before the justified start date
Language Languages the review team can reliably screen and analyse Full text unavailable in a supported language

Language and publication-status restrictions can introduce bias, so state and justify them. “Peer reviewed only” is not automatically superior if the question concerns emerging practice or publication bias. Align sources with the dissertation’s purpose and resources.

A scoping review may use broader criteria to map concepts, populations, and evidence types. A meta-analysis may need additional rules about effect-size information, independence, and comparable outcomes. Do not exclude a relevant study solely because an effect size is not printed; it may be calculable or obtainable from authors.

Criteria for secondary data and records

In a secondary data dissertation, the case may be a participant record, assessment occasion, or organisation. Define the source dataset, observation window, required variables, duplicate handling, and whether linked records must meet a matching-quality threshold.

Separate eligibility from missing-data treatment. A record lacking the primary outcome may be ineligible for the primary analysis, but a record with one missing covariate may still contribute under a prespecified missing-data method. Blanket complete-case eligibility can silently change the target population and reduce precision.

Also distinguish data-quality checks from implausible-value decisions. Define valid ranges from the instrument or data dictionary before inspecting associations. Record correction, recoding, and exclusion decisions in a reproducible log.

Prevent avoidable selection bias

Narrow criteria can improve internal interpretability while weakening external relevance. Broad criteria can improve applicability while increasing heterogeneity or practical complexity. There is no universally correct width. The aim is a justified match between the research question, design, risks, and intended inference.

Ask who becomes invisible under each rule. Age, disability, language, location, digital access, diagnosis, pregnancy, and comorbidity restrictions may remove groups that experience the phenomenon differently. An exclusion should not be copied from an unrelated study merely because it looks conventional.

Use a criterion audit

  1. State the target population in one sentence.
  2. List every proposed criterion and its information source.
  3. Write a one-sentence justification for each rule.
  4. Identify groups disproportionately removed by the rule.
  5. Consider accommodation, stratification, measurement, or sensitivity analysis as alternatives.
  6. Check that the remaining sample can still answer the research question.
  7. Review the final criteria with the supervisor and ethics process before recruitment or screening.

This audit does not remove all bias. It makes trade-offs visible and helps the researcher avoid criteria based only on convenience or untested assumptions.

Plan screening before data collection

Create a screening form with one item per criterion, permitted response options, the information source, and instructions for ambiguous cases. Pilot it on a small set of hypothetical or real cases that are not part of the final analysis when appropriate.

For participant studies, collect only information needed to determine eligibility. Protect screening data under the approved data management plan. Explain what happens to information from people who are screened but not enrolled.

For reviews, train at least two screeners when the protocol requires independent decisions. Calibrate interpretations on a sample of records, document disagreements, and use a predefined resolution process. A reason such as “wrong population” should correspond to a written rule, not an intuitive judgement.

Create a transparent decision hierarchy

A case may fail several criteria. For a flow diagram, choose a consistent hierarchy for the primary exclusion reason. For example: duplicate, wrong population, wrong phenomenon or intervention, wrong outcome, wrong design, unavailable full text. The hierarchy prevents the reported reason from depending on which criterion a screener notices first.

Keep an audit trail without exposing confidential details. Record the date, decision, coded reason, screener, and resolution of uncertainty. For participant research, do not include identifying information in the dissertation flow chart.

Handle ambiguity and protocol changes

Real cases expose gaps in apparently clear criteria. A participant may be between education stages, a record may span the time boundary, or a review paper may include a mixed-age sample. Anticipate these cases with rules such as a required subgroup result, a percentage threshold, or author contact.

If a criterion must change after screening or recruitment starts, do not quietly rewrite the method. Record what changed, when, why, which cases were affected, and whether ethics or protocol amendments were needed. Update the preregistration or protocol record where applicable. Consider a sensitivity analysis if the change could alter conclusions.

Common mistakes and repairs

Mistake Why it matters Repair
Repeating the target population as the only criterion Screeners cannot apply an abstract label consistently Define observable characteristics, sources, and boundaries
Using exclusion as the logical opposite of every inclusion rule Creates redundant lists and hides special disqualifying conditions State all required inclusion conditions, then list distinct exclusions
Choosing cutoffs after seeing the data Allows results to influence sample composition Prespecify thresholds and justify them
Calling attrition an exclusion Conceals participant flow and may bias analysis Report eligibility, enrolment, withdrawal, completion, and analysis separately
Excluding missing data without a plan Can change the analytic population unpredictably Define required variables and missing-data methods in advance
Using broad safety exclusions May be unfair and reduce applicability Link each restriction to a concrete procedure and risk
Giving no full-text exclusion reasons in a review Readers cannot reproduce selection Use a coded log and report a flow diagram

A dissertation-ready reporting template

Adapt the following structure rather than copying it unchanged:

Cases were eligible when they met all of the following criteria: [criterion, operational definition, and source]; [criterion, definition, and source]; and [criterion, definition, and source]. Cases were excluded when [distinct disqualifying condition] or [distinct condition]. These rules were selected because [scientific, measurement, ethical, and feasibility rationale]. Eligibility was assessed by [who] using [form or procedure] before [enrolment, extraction, or analysis]. Ambiguous cases were resolved by [process]. Participant or record flow and reasons for exclusion were documented using [method].

In the dissertation, place the complete criteria in the methods chapter. Report recruitment or search sources, screening procedure, numbers at each stage, and reasons for exclusion in the results or study-flow section. Discuss how the rules affect transferability or generalisability in the limitations.

Final quality checklist

  • Every criterion follows from the research question or protocol.
  • Each rule is observable, bounded, and consistently applicable.
  • Thresholds and timeframes have a stated rationale.
  • Eligibility, sampling, withdrawal, attrition, and analysis exclusions are separate.
  • Unnecessary demographic, diagnostic, language, and access restrictions have been challenged.
  • Screening information is collected and stored ethically.
  • Ambiguous cases and protocol changes have a documented process.
  • Participant or record flow can be reported transparently.
  • The criteria match the approved ethics application, protocol, and analysis plan.

Frequently asked questions

How many inclusion and exclusion criteria should a dissertation have?

There is no correct number. Include every rule necessary to define the analytic population and protect the protocol, but remove redundant or unjustified restrictions. A short, precise list is stronger than a long list copied from previous studies.

Should exclusion criteria be the opposite of inclusion criteria?

Usually not. If inclusion requires age 18 or older, “under 18” need not be repeated as an exclusion. Reserve the exclusion list for distinct disqualifying conditions, such as prior exposure to an experimental task or a protocol-specific safety issue.

Can language be an inclusion criterion?

Yes, when valid consent, interviewing, or measurement is only available in specified languages. State the practical and measurement reason, consider translation or interpretation where feasible, and discuss how the restriction affects the population represented.

Can incomplete questionnaires be excluded?

Do not use a blanket rule unless it is justified. Define which variables are required for each analysis, distinguish participant withdrawal from item nonresponse, and apply the prespecified missing-data plan. Report the number and reasons for analysis exclusions.

When should review eligibility criteria be finalised?

Finalise them in the protocol before formal screening. Pilot screening may reveal ambiguous wording, which can be clarified transparently before or early in screening. Log any later amendment and its effect on included records.

Where should criteria appear in a dissertation?

State them in the methods chapter, alongside recruitment or search procedures. Report the number screened, excluded, included, completed, and analysed in the results or flow section. Reflect on the resulting boundaries of inference in the discussion.

Conclusion

Strong inclusion and exclusion criteria are concise decision rules, not decorative methods text. They connect the research question to the cases that produce evidence, make screening reproducible, protect participants, and show readers where conclusions apply. Draft them before selection begins, justify every restriction, record decisions consistently, and report the resulting flow without hiding attrition or post hoc exclusions.
